For over three decades, CAV Restaurant has been a Providence institution, offering an exquisite fine dining experience. Located in a unique and eclectic historic loft, this New American restaurant and bar is celebrated for its award-winning contemporary cuisine. Guests can enjoy a meal in the elegant dining room or at the historic 200-year-old bar. CAV, which stands for Cocktails, Antiques, and Victuals, provides a sophisticated inviting atmosphere for any occasion.

An eatery/antique shop featuring an upscale global menu, a historic bar & music.

I have had several excellent dinner experiences at CAV, and was looking forward to trying brunch. Unfortunately, I was somewhat disappointed.

The interior of CAV is eclectic in the best way. I’ve heard the owners traveled to Africa and returned with artifacts and a dream of opening a restaurant. I’m not sure. But the room is absolutely packed with interesting objects.

For brunch this time, the food was all over the place. The coffee and desserts were delicious… These are the things they also offer at dinner time.
The bruschetta was alright, but it, along with the other dishes we tried, displayed absolutely lazy and sloppy knife work. Ingredients were hacked into large chunks and uneven slices at a novice level.
For my main, I got lobster and eggs. These were both cooked very well. But it was topped with this storebought-tasting, sickly syrupy Thai chili sauce which tainted the whole dish.

The service was also haphazard. Our server was very nice, but the timing was off. Somebody took our menus before we had the chance to order. It took a long time to get our check and then get the cards run. We saw our server trying to complete shift change tasks; perhaps there’s some process optimization that could be made to alleviate this midday scramble.

Overall it was a pleasant brunch, but I know what CAV is capable of, and this brunch was not firing on all cylinders.
